Mountain bike trails around Pleine-Sève offer access to diverse landscapes within the Seine-Maritime department of Normandy. The region features an extensive network of trails, accommodating riders of all skill levels. Terrain varies from coastal paths with sea views to more demanding routes through wooded and hilly areas. The area is characterized by its dramatic coastline, lush river valleys, and serene countryside.

Itinerary with almost no roads (mainly dirt and coastal paths through fields and small sections of departmental and municipal roads) in very pretty natural environments. Especially the beach and the surroundings of Saint-Aubin-sur-Mer! However, some sad old fly-tipping and rarer more recent ones on the coastal paths and other points can be annoying. Also pay attention to the weather on the day of the outing and the previous days because some sections can become very muddy + some passages in the vegetation can transform, with growth, into slightly narrower and difficult to use spaces (mainly coastal paths). The erosion of the cliff seems to be accelerating in some parts and could make access to certain areas of the coastal paths more complex or even cut off in the (fairly) near future. Allow a good seven hours (minimum) in total with a few short breaks.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Pleine-Sève?

There are 37 mountain bike trails around Pleine-Sève listed on komoot, offering a diverse range of experiences. The broader Seine-Maritime department, where Pleine-Sève is located, boasts over 1,000 kilometers of trails dedicated to mountain biking, catering to all skill lev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ails near Pleine-Sève?

The terrain around Pleine-Sève is quite varied. You'll find trails ranging from easy, well-maintained paths, often with scenic sea views along the coast, to more demanding routes with steep climbs and technical descents in wooded and hilly areas. Expect dense forests, picturesque river valleys, and charming countryside paths through fields and orchards.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Pleine-Sève?

Yes, Pleine-Sève offers 15 easy mountain bike routes, making it suitable for beginners and families. A great option is the Hollow Way Trail – Hollow Way Trail loop from Saint-Valery-en-Caux, an easy 17.0 km trail that explores the countryside near the charming coastal town. Another easy, scenic choice is the Hollow Way Trail – Hollow Way Trail loop from Veules-les-Roses, which is 18.0 km long.

Can I find more challenging mountain bike routes around Pleine-Sève?

While there are no routes classified as 'difficult' directly around Pleine-Sève, there are 22 moderate mountain bike trails that offer a good challenge. For example, the Lin Cycle Route – Véloroute du Lin loop from Saint-Pierre-le-Viger is a moderate 50.5 km trail leading through rural landscapes, often completed in about 2 hours 43 minutes.

What are some scenic viewpoints or natural attractions I can see while mountain biking?

The region offers breathtaking natural beauty. You can encounter dramatic coastal views along the Côte d'Albâtre, including impressive chalk cliffs. Highlights near the trails include the Cliffs of Sotteville-sur-Mer Coastal Path, the Question Mark Viewpoint, and The panorama of the chalk cliffs. The trails also wind through lush forests and along the picturesque Seine Valley.

Are there any historical or cultural landmarks near the mountain bike trails?

Yes, the area is rich in history and charm. You might pass by the Château de Mesnil Geoffroy or the Château de Janville and its gardens. The charming coastal towns like Saint-Valery-en-Caux and Veules-les-Roses, with attractions like The Veules River and the Watermills of Veules-les-Roses, are also easily accessible and offer a glimpse into local heritage.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Pleine-Sève?

The region's diverse landscapes, including coastal routes, forests, and countryside, are enjoyable thro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n generally off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ery, with vibrant foliage or blooming flowers. Summer is also popular, especially for coastal rides, though trails might be busier. Winter riding is possible, but conditions can vary, particularly in wooded areas.

Are there options for food and drink or accommodation near the trails?

Pleine-Sève is situated near several charming coastal towns and villages such as Saint-Valery-en-Caux (6 km away) and Veules-les-Roses (7 km away). These locations offer various options for cafes, restaurants, and accommodation, providing convenient places to refuel and relax after your ride.
